Two Iranians on 8th revised AFC Player of the Year list

KUALA LUMPUR: The race to scoop the coveted AFC Player of the Year award has entered an interesting phase with the technical experts weighing in with their picks.

AFC

The six lists published till date were based on the Most Valuable Player selections by AFC Match Commissioners and these same line-ups have now been reviewed by two technical analysts.

Following the review, seven new players have stormed into the reckoning for the coveted award which was won by Saudi Arabia’s Yasser Al Qahtani last year from a tough three-man field which also comprised Iraqi stalwarts Younes Mahmoud and Nashat Akram.

Prolific Qatari striker Sebastian Quintana (Soria), Australia’s Nathan Burns, Thailand’s Kosin Haithairattankool and Nantawat Thaensopa, Syrian Mahmoud Karkar, Mitsuo Ogasawara of Japan and Ubzek Zaynitdin Tadjiyev have caught the eye of the technical analysts to make the cut.

Further, the opinion of fans started impacting the selection from September and their choice will be reflected in future short-lists.

EIGHTH LIST OF CONTENDERS FOR AFC PLAYER OF THE YEAR 2008
(in alphabetical order; revised list as of October 2, 2008)

1. Ahmad Ajab ( Kuwait and Al Qadsia – Kuwait )
2. Ali Al Habsi ( Oman and Bolton Wanderers – England )
3. Andres Sebastian Soria Quintana ( Qatar and Qatar SC – Qatar )
4. Ebrahim Sadeghi ( Iran and Saipa – Iran )
5. Hong Yong-jo (DPR Korea and FK Bezanija – Serbia )
6. Ismael Matar (UAE and Al Wahda – UAE)
7. Javad Nekounam ( Iran and Osasuna – Spain )
8. Jehad Al Hussein ( Syria and Kuwait SC – Kuwait )
9. Kim Do-heon ( Korea Republic and WBA – England )
10. Kosin Haithairattankool ( Thailand and Chonburi – Thailand )
11. Odil Ahmedov ( Uzbekistan and Pakhtakor – Uzbekistan )
12. Mahmoud Karkar ( Syria and Al Ittihad – Syria )
13. Mitsuo Ogasawara ( Japan and Kashima Antlers - Japan )
14. Nantawat Thaensopa ( Thailand and Krung Thai Bank – Thailand )
15. Nathan Burns ( Australia and AEK Athens – Greece )
16. Server Djeparov ( Uzbekistan and Kuruvchi/Bunyodkor – Uzbekistan )
17. Yasser Al Qahtani ( Saudi Arabia and Al Hilal – Saudi Arabia )
18. Yuji Nakazawa ( Japan and Yokohama F Marinos – Japan )
19. Zaynitdin Tadjiyev ( Uzbekistan and Pakhtakor – Uzbekistan )
